The Bachelor of Arts in Diplomacy and International Relations study plan at Dar Al-Hekma University is an accredited bachelor programme spanning about 4 years (8 academic levels), requiring 120 credit hours across 43 courses of required and elective study. The table below lists the courses and their credit hours for each level.

Year One - Fall 13 credits

Code Course Credits
BAIR 1310 Globalization and Social Change 3
BBBF 1101 Basic Body and Brain Fitness 1
MATH 1301 College Algebra 3
ISLS XXXX Islamic Studies 3
COMM 1301 Communication Skills I 3

Year One - Spring 18 credits

Code Course Credits
BAIR 1311 Introduction to International Relations 3
BAIR 1301 Introduction to Law 3
ARAB XXXX Arabic Studies 3
BAIR 1320 Introduction to Comparative Politics 3
BAIR 1312 Processes of International Negotiation 3
COMM 1302 Communication Skills II 3

Year Two - Fall 15 credits

Code Course Credits
ISLS XXXX Islamic Studies 3
GELE 3301 Leadership and Emotional Intelligence 3
BAIR 2330 International Law 3
BSBF 1320 Principles of Microeconomics 3
STAT 2301 Statistics 3

Year Two - Spring 15 credits

Code Course Credits
BAIR 2313 International Organizations 3
BAIR 2321 Introduction to Geo-politics 3
BSBF 1321 Principles of Macroeconomics 3
GEAI 2301 Introduction to Artificial Intelligence 3
HIST 2301 History of the Modern Middle East 3

Year Three - Fall 18 credits

Code Course Credits
BSBF 4322 International Macroeconomics 3
BAIR 2322 Diplomacy and Statecraft 3
BAIR 3323 Foreign Policy of Saudi Arabia 3
ENTR 3301 Entrepreneurship and Design Thinking 3
XXXX XXXX Major Elective 3
BAIR 3325 Media and Politics 3

Year Three - Spring 18 credits

Code Course Credits
BAIR 3340 International Trade 3
BAIR 3314 The Rise and Fall of Great Powers 3
BAIR 3324 Culture, Society and Political Power 3
GERM 3301 Research Methodology 3
XXXX XXXX Major Elective 3
BAIR 3316 Internship 3

Year Four - Fall 15 credits

Code Course Credits
BAIR 4315 Senior Project 1 3
BAIR 4341 Political Economy in Comparative Perspective 3
HIST 1301 Contemporary World History 3
BAIR 4304 Migration, Refugees and Citizenship in a Globalized World 3
XXXX XXXX Major Elective 3

Year Four - Spring 15 credits

Code Course Credits
XXXX XXXX Free Elective 3
BAIR 4317 Cross-cultural Communication 3
BAIR 4326 Politics, Culture, and Environmental Sustainability 3
BAIR 4318 Senior Project 2 3
BAIR 4327 International Security and Causes of Modern War 3
